Ticket: Unlock migration vault for Ironvine ORM refactor

New team members: the legacy Ironvine ORM layer is being replaced module by module, and the schema snapshots needed for safe refactoring sit in a locked vault nobody has opened since the last owner left. We recovered the credentials from escrow this week. The passphrase follows below.

unlock words, kajog-yawip: istwyn-casath-aldok

Handover note — Crumbwheel order cutoffs.

Welcome aboard. The bakery cutoff rule in Crumbwheel closes same-day orders at 14:00 local to each storefront, not UTC — this has bitten us twice. Holiday overrides live in the calendar service and take precedence silently, so always check there first when a cutoff looks wrong. To unlock the calendar service's admin console after a restart, enter the recovery passphrase below.

vault phrase of bagap-bahaf = silion-pelox-sorox-casdor-quenwyn-fraax-eliox-praael-kelion-quenvan-kasox-rusael-norius-belvan

## Runbook — Pushpipe websocket reconnect storm

Welcome aboard! Every so often Pushpipe clients get stuck in a reconnect loop after a node drain — the server drops them, they all retry at once, and the handshake queue backs up. The fix is usually just bumping backoff jitter and draining more slowly. Before you touch anything, compare the live node against the standard settings, listed right here.

config for kafof-bawef:
holath:
  log_level: debug
  metrics_host: metrics.holath.qorvelsys.internal
  pin: 2191
  pool_size: 32

**09:17** — Folks noticed Graphlet, our dependency visualizer, was rendering cycles that didn't exist. Turns out the 2.4 release cached edge data across workspaces. 09:33 — Priya flipped the cache flag off in staging, confirmed graphs rendered correctly. 09:51 — hotfix merged, pushed to all tenants by 10:10. No downstream build decisions were made off the bad graphs, thankfully. The hotfix build is identified by the token below.

pipeline stamp: htk6_35e0c9